My Brother's Keeper: James Joyce's Early Years

New York: The Viking Press, 1958. First edition. Hardcover. 8vo. [7], viii-xxii, [2], 3-266 pp. Quarter green cloth over green paper boards with gold lettering on the spine; green topstain. Price of $5.00 on the front flap of the dust jacket. Illustrated with a plate, a photograph of the author in 1905 on the recto, a photograph of the author in 1955 on the recto. Stanislaus Joyce was three years younger than James Joyce, and the brothers were very close. Joyce's biography of his brother ends with James Joyce's 22nd year. Stanislaus Joyce records observations of the Joyce family, their life in Ireland, the exile in Trieste, and the adventures he and James Joyce engaged in during their youth.
